gpt4 book ai didi

apache - 有条件地设置 Apache header

转载 作者:行者123 更新时间:2023-12-04 01:36:29 25 4
gpt4 key购买 nike

我正在使用 apache 服务器,我想有条件地添加 header 。

如果 URI 匹配某个正则表达式,我想添加标题 Access-Control-Allow-Origin: * .有什么好的方法可以做到这一点?

到目前为止我尝试过的:

  • 我添加了由请求处理程序调用的代码,使用 apr_table_add(rq->headers_out, "Access-Control-Allow-Origin", "*") .但是,每当 header Content-Type: application/x-javascript 发送响应之前,Apache 似乎都会剥离 header 。也设置了。这是错误的做法吗?为什么 Apache 会剥离 header ?
  • 我听说 mod_headers 建议。 mod_headers 是否能够根据与请求 URI 匹配的正则表达式来放置 header ?
  • 最佳答案

    SetEnvIf Request_URI somepartofurl SIGN
    Header always add "Access-Control-Allow-Origin" "*" env=SIGN

    但这仅在位于配置中时才有效。将其放入 .htaccess 无济于事。

    关于apache - 有条件地设置 Apache header 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21270902/

    25 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com